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4235213737 08927 107718152 4709150610 10636802
5689179955 42 5649
5689179955 42 5649
780 850 109214
All about undefined
Interested in learning more?
5689179955 42 5649
780 850 109214
See more
536078010 909349
84820 078 02
See more
722874 65 54349066580
37141798 6533 4104 406234296
See more